Building a new home in Montana involves meeting specific standards to ensure it is comfortable, healthy, and energy-efficient. One of the most critical steps in this process is the blower door test. This diagnostic tool is not just a recommendation; it is a requirement for all new residential construction across the state.
A blower door is a diagnostic tool used by energy professionals and builders alike to measure a home's airtightness. The setup consists of a variable-speed fan mounted into a flexible panel that fits securely within the frame of an exterior doorway.
To perform the test, the fan pulls air out of the house, lowering the internal air pressure. This depressurization forces higher-pressure outside air to flow in through any unsealed gaps, cracks, or penetrations in the "building envelope"—the shell that separates the conditioned interior from the outdoors. In some cases, the fan may be reversed to pressurize the home instead.
A calibrated blower door includes a digital pressure gauge, known as a manometer, which measures the pressure difference between the inside and outside to quantify the exact rate of air leakage.

During the test, professionals may also use infrared cameras or smoke pencils to pinpoint specific leak locations, such as around recessed lights or wiring penetrations.
In Montana, the state energy code provides the minimum requirements for the efficient design and construction of all new residential homes. Under these regulations, a blower door test is mandatory to confirm that air sealing requirements have been met.
